Mark Davis wrote: > > What wasn't clear from his message > is whether Mozilla picks a reasonable font if the language is not there. Sorry about the lack of clarity. When there is no LANG attribute in the element (or in a parent element), Mozilla uses the document's charset as a fallback. Mozilla has font preferences for each language group. The language groups have been set up to have a one-to-one correspondence with charsets (roughly). E.g. iso-8859-1 -> Western, shift_jis -> ja. When the charset is a Unicode-based one (e.g. UTF-8), then Mozilla uses the language group that contains the user's locale's language. In other words, Mozilla does not (yet) use the Unicode character codes to select fonts. We may do this in the future. Erik
